Question 290132: The ages of a father and a son add up to 55. The father's age is the sons age reversed.

10a+b+10b+a=55
11a+11b=55
11*(a+b)=55
a+b=5
x+y=55
x=10a+b
y=10b+a
Not enough info.
There are three possibilities
05,50
14,41
23,32
